JONESBORO, AR — (BrooklandNews.com) — July 28, 2025 — The Craighead County Jonesboro Public Library will host Arkansas native and American Idol finalist Marybeth Byrd for a free, family-friendly concert this fall.
The performance is scheduled for Thursday, Sept. 18 at 6 p.m. on the library’s front lawn, according to a post from the library’s Facebook page. Seating will be limited, and attendees are encouraged to bring lawn chairs or blankets.
Byrd, a singer from Armorel, Arkansas, gained national attention as a top 10 finalist on Season 21 of ABC’s “American Idol.” She performs across multiple genres, including country, Christian and pop.
In addition to live music, the event will feature free frozen custard provided by Andy’s Frozen Custard. The library described the evening as a “family-friendly community event” and invited residents of all ages to take part in what it called a celebration of “your library and your story.”
The concert is sponsored by the First Horizon Foundation, Farmers & Merchants Bank, Friends of the Craighead County Jonesboro Public Library, and St. Bernards Healthcare & Medical Group.
